Temperature controlled surface hydrophobicity and interaction forces induced by poly (N-isopropylacrylamide)

Summary

Poly (N-isopropylacrylamide) (PNIPAM), a temperature-responsive polymer, enhances silica surface hydrophobicity above its LCST. This leads to increased adhesion between surfaces, crucial for mineral flotation applications.
